Building Your Professional Profile in Canada: How Much Does It Cost?

Navigating the job market in Canada can be difficult, especially when you're trying to your perfect career move. A well-written resume is vital to making a strong initial impact. But with so many options available, it's normal to wonder: how much does professional resume writing expend?

On average, the cost of resume writing services in Canada can vary from hundreds of dollars to over $500. The fee you pay will depend on a range of factors, including the level of your resume needs, the experience of the writer, and any extra features included.
